Separate out enabling building clang and/or gcc for the system and
building clang and/or gcc as the bootstrap compiler. Normally, the
default compiler is used. WITH_CLANG_BOOTSTRAP and/or
WITH_GCC_BOOTSTRAP will enable building these compilers as part
bootstrap phase. WITH/WITHOUT_CLANG_IS_CC controls which compiler is
used by default for the bootstrap phase, as well as which compiler is
installed as cc. buildworld now successfully completes building the
cross compiler with WITHOUT_CLANG=t and WITHOUT_GCC=t and produces a
built system with neither of these included.
Similarlly, MK_BINUTILS_BOOTSTRAP controls whether binutils is built
during this phase.
WITHOUT_CROSS_COMPILER will now force MK_BINUTILS_BOOTSTRAP=no,
MK_CLANG_BOOTSTRAP=no and MK_GCC_BOOTSTRAP=no.
BOOTSTRAP_COMPILER was considered, but rejected, since pc98 needs both
clang and gcc to bootstrap still. It should be revisisted in the
future if this requirement goes away. Values should be gcc, clang or
none. It could also be a list.
The odd interaction with Xfoo cross/external tools needs work, but
is beyond the scope of this change as well.

For NFS mounts using rsize,wsize=65536 over TSO enabled
network interfaces limited to 32 transmit segments, there
are two known issues.
The more serious one is that for an I/O of slightly less than 64K,
the net device driver prepends an ethernet header, resulting in a
TSO segment slightly larger than 64K. Since m_defrag() copies this
into 33 mbuf clusters, the transmit fails with EFBIG.
A tester indicated observing a similar failure using iSCSI.
The second less critical problem is that the network
device driver must copy the mbuf chain via m_defrag()
(m_collapse() is not sufficient), resulting in measurable overhead.
This patch reduces the default size of if_hw_tsomax
slightly, so that the first issue is avoided.
Fixing the second issue will require a way for the
network device driver to inform tcp_output() that it
is limited to 32 transmit segments.

when watchdogd is asked to exit nicely (via SIGTERM) it will
stop timer. since watchdogd rc.d script is marked as 'shutdown'
it will exit (on shutdown) and stop timer. if system happens to
hung after watchdogd exited, manual reset is required. when one
operates in "lights-out" type of environments and without
readily available "remote hands" it could create a problem.
this provides ability to override "stop signal" for watchdogd.
default behavior is preserved, i.e. watchdogd will still be killed
via SIGTERM and timer will be stopped. in order to activate new
feature, one needs to put
watchdogd_sig_stop="KILL"
into /etc/rc.conf and also make sure watchdogd timeout is set
to long enough value allowing system to come back online before
timeout fires.

Vlan did not set the value of if_hw_tsomax, so when vlan
was stacked on top of a network interface that set if_hw_tsomax,
tcp_output() would see the default value instead of the value
set by the network interface. This patch modifies vlan so that
it sets if_hw_tsomax to the value of the parent interface.

Make sure not to do I/O for more than MAXPHYS bytes. Doing so can cause
problems in our providers, such as a KASSERT in md(4). We can initiate
I/O for more than MAXPHYS bytes if we've been given a BIO for MAXPHYS
bytes, the blocks from which we're reading couldn't be compressed and
we had compression in preceeding blocks resulting in misalignment of
the blocks we're trying to read relative to the sector. We're forced to
round up the I/O length to make it an multiple of the sector size.
When we detect the condition, we'll reduce the block count and perform
a "short" read. In g_uzip_done() we need to consider the original I/O
length and stop early if we're about to deflate a block that we didn't
read. By using bio_completed in the cloned BIO and not bio_length to
check for this, we automatically and gracefully handle short reads that
our providers may be doing on top of the short reads we may initiate
ourselves.

When merging docsinstall and zfsboot updates to stable/9 it was discovered
that the slightly older dialog(1) requires --separate-output when using the
--checklist widget to force response to produce unquoted values (whereas in
stable/10 --checklist widget without --separate-output will only quote the
checklist labels in the response if the label is multi-word (contains any
whitespace).
Since these enhancements (see revisions 263956 and 264437) were developed
originally on 10, the --separate-output option was omitted. When merged to
stable/9, we (Allan Jude) and I found during testing that the "always-
quoting" of the response was causing things like struct interpolation to
fail (`f_struct device_$dev' would produce `f_struct device_\"da0\"' for
example -- literal quotes inherited from dialog(1) --checklist response).
To see the behavior, execute the following on stable/9 versus stable/10:
dialog --checklist disks: 0 0 0 da0 "" off da1 "" off
Check both items and hit enter. On stable/10, the response is:
da0 da1
On stable/9 the response is:
"da0" "da1"
If you use the --separate-output option, the response is the same for both:
da0
da1
So applying --separate-output on every platform until either one of two
things occurs 1) dialog(1,3) gets synchronized between stable/9, higher or
2) we drop support for stable/9.
